How To Turn Off Live Photos

Introduction

Live Photos, introduced by Apple, bring your images to life by capturing a few seconds of video footage before and after you take a picture. While this feature adds motion and depth to your photos, it may not always be necessary or desirable. Whether you want to conserve storage space, improve privacy, or simply prefer static images, turning off Live Photos is a simple process. In this article, we will guide you through the steps to disable Live Photos on your Apple device.

Why Turn Off Live Photos?

Save Storage Space: Live Photos consume more storage compared to regular images because they include both video and audio elements.
Privacy Concerns: The video snippets captured in Live Photos may inadvertently capture sensitive or private information.
Battery Life: Constantly recording and playing back Live Photos can have a minor impact on your device’s battery life.
Preference for Static Images: Some users simply prefer traditional, non-moving images without any additional features.

How to Turn Off Live Photos on iPhone

If you own an iPhone and want to disable Live Photos, follow these simple steps:

1. Open the Camera app on your iPhone.
2. Look for the Live Photos icon, represented by concentric circles at the top of the screen. It should be yellow if Live Photos are currently enabled.
3. Tap on the Live Photos icon to turn it off. It should no longer be highlighted, indicating that Live Photos are now disabled.
4. You can now take photos as usual, and they will be saved as static images without the Live Photos feature.

How to Turn Off Live Photos on iPad

To disable Live Photos on your iPad, use the following steps:

1. Launch the Camera app on your iPad.
2. Locate the Live Photos icon in the camera interface. It resembles concentric circles and will be highlighted if Live Photos are active.
3. Tap on the Live Photos icon to toggle the feature off. The icon should no longer be highlighted, indicating that Live Photos have been turned off.
4. You can now capture photos on your iPad without the Live Photos feature, saving storage space and avoiding unwanted motion in your pictures.

How to Turn Off Live Photos on Mac

If you are using a Mac and want to disable Live Photos, you can do so with the Photos app:

1. Open the Photos app on your Mac.
2. Select the Live Photo you want to turn off.
3. Right-click on the Live Photo to open a drop-down menu.
4. Choose “Turn Off Live Photo” from the options. This action will convert the Live Photo into a static image.
5. The Live Photo will be saved as a regular picture without motion effects.

Additional Tips for Managing Live Photos

View Live Photos: Even if you have turned off Live Photos, you can still view and enjoy existing Live Photos in your camera roll.
Share Live Photos: You can share Live Photos with others who have compatible devices. However, when shared with non-Apple users or platforms, Live Photos may be converted into static images.
Back Up Live Photos: Make sure to back up your Live Photos to iCloud or another cloud storage service to preserve them safely.
Adjust Live Photo Key Photo: If you want to change the key frame of a Live Photo, you can do so in the Photos app on your iPhone or Mac.
